🧭 Travel Tips for Ayodhya Tour Packages
- Best Time to Visit: October to March offers pleasant weather and festive vibes.
- Getting There: Ayodhya is well-connected by rail and road. The new Ayodhya airport adds convenience for air travelers.
- Stay Options: Packages include budget hotels, heritage stays, and premium accommodations.
- Local Etiquette: Dress modestly, respect temple customs, and avoid littering at ghats and sacred sites.
🌅 Add-On Destinations
Many Ayodhya Tour Packages offer optional excursions to nearby spiritual and heritage spots:
- Faizabad: Mughal-era gardens and Nawabi architecture.
- Chitrakoot: Associated with Lord Rama’s exile years.
- Prayagraj: Triveni Sangam and ancient temples.
- Varanasi: Ganga Aarti and Kashi Vishwanath Temple.
These add-ons enrich your journey and offer a broader spiritual circuit.
